A REGENCY BRASS-INLAID EBONISED TIMEPIECE BRACKET CLOCK WITH MUSICAL MOVEMENT
GEORGE WILKINS, LONDON, CIRCA 1820
CASE: surmounted by a pinecone finial and inlaid with swags, quatrefoils, and floral motifs, the finial, upper mouldings and bracket later DIAL: white enamel dial with Roman hours and signed GEO. WILKINS/FRITH ST. SOHO, tune selection dial beneath concealed by door MOVEMENT: chain fusee timepiece movement with dead beat escapement, this movement mounted on a chain fusee musical movement playing three tunes on eight bells, tripped every hour or at will
22. 1/2 in. (57 cm.) high, overall; 8 ½ in. (22 cm.) wide; 6 in. (15 cm.) deep
